区域自动气象站资料报表制作与共享系统
- 格式:pdf
- 大小:588.59 KB
- 文档页数:4
基于firebird数据库系统的区域站资料整理软件设计基于firebird数据库系统的区域站资料整理软件设计为便于对区域自动气象观测站资料进行统计处理,提高区域自动气象观测站资料的利用率,对区域自动气象站实时地面气象数据进行统一处理和存储,开发区域自动气象站历史资料处理软件十分必要。
1 资料现状区域自动气象观测站资料大多保存的是各要素整点数据,每个站每天就有24个文件,每个省的区域站数量达到了2千个,每天各省收到的区域站资料文件数就已经达到了2万以上,如此大的数据量,还以这种离散的数据文件的形式来保存,是不利于区域站数据的检索和应用的,将这种离散的数据文件整理成一个统一格式的数据包是此软件完成的主要任务之一。
2 整理方法2.1 软件的工作流程此软件系统的处理流程分为三个阶段:将不同格式的区域站资料自动批量导入到FireBird数据库中,在导入的过程中对数据资料进行格式检查;然后,将数据库中的数据进行内部处理,利用数据库的统计功能计算饱和水汽压等统计项,同时按照预先在数据库中台站信息表中设定的气候极值对个数据要素进行质量控制;最后,按照用户选择的时间段输出区域站文本资料。
2.2 Firbird数据库Firbird数据库是一个跨平台的开源数据库系统,其设计定位是面向企业开放源代码数据库,是一个全功能的、高效的、轻量级、免维护的数据库。
2.2.1 Firbird数据库开发单机版软件的优势MSSQL、Oracle、My SQL等传统的大型数据库软件发布和维护成本高,不易移植,软件的部署和安装需要先预安装数据库系统,然后附加数据库实例,与数据库连接的软件也要做相应的设置,通常应用于大型的企业软件和网络软件。
与传统的数据库相比,Firebird数据库在开发单机版软件方面具有以本文由收集整理下优点:发布简易;功能强大且高效稳定;存储量大;支持SQL 标准;高度可移植性;编译环境良好。
2.2.2 Firbird数据库的访问方式Firebird 支持多种数据库访问方式,各种应用都能通过Firebird 动态库fbclient.dll 访问数据库;对于各种编译器访问Firebird 应用,可通过ODBC/ADO/JDBC 接口访问;对于Firebird 自身应用,可通过自身解释器执行语句直接进行访问;如果Firebird 要直接访问,则可通过Firebird的C、C++ 和JAVA 等接口直接访问。
区域自动站在气象服务中的重要作用随着气象科技的不断发展,区域自动站在气象服务中的作用日益重要。
区域自动站是由气象仪器设备组成的自动观测系统,能够自动采集和传输气象要素数据,并实时展示和分析气象信息,为气象服务和气象预报提供重要依据。
下面将从气象服务的角度,阐述区域自动站在气象服务中的重要作用。
区域自动站能够提供实时的气象观测数据,为气象预报和灾害预警提供重要依据。
区域自动站能够实时采集和传输气象要素数据,包括温度、湿度、气压、风速风向等,为气象预报模型提供必要的输入参数。
通过区域自动站提供的实时气象观测数据,气象预报可以更加准确地预测未来天气的变化趋势,为社会经济生产和人们的出行提供科学依据。
区域自动站还能够监测地质灾害、气象灾害等突发事件的发生和发展,及时发布灾害预警信息,保障人民群众的生命财产安全。
区域自动站能够提供气象要素的长期观测数据,为气候研究和气候预测提供重要数据支持。
区域自动站可以进行气象要素的长期观测,包括多年的温度、降水、风速等数据。
这些数据对于研究气候变化、分析气候特征、评估气候变化的影响等具有重要意义。
通过长期观测数据的积累,可以更好地预测未来气候的发展趋势,为农业、水利、林业等行业的生产经营提供科学的气象支持。
区域自动站能够提供气象信息的共享和交换,加强中国与世界各国之间的气象合作。
区域自动站设备先进,系统稳定,数据准确可靠,能够为国内外气象机构和研究机构提供气象观测数据。
通过区域自动站的数据共享和交换,不仅可以促进气象观测技术的进步,提高气象服务的质量和水平,还有利于加强国际气象合作,共同应对全球气候变化等气象灾害的挑战。
区域自动站能够提供多元化的气象服务产品,满足社会经济发展的需要。
区域自动站可以根据不同用户的需求,提供多种形式的气象服务产品。
为农业生产提供气象决策支持,预测适宜的播种期和收获期;为交通运输提供天气预报和路况信息,提供安全出行的建议;为旅游业提供气象景观预报和旅游气象服务等。
区域自动气象站区域自动气象站 (Regional Automatic Weather Stations)介绍:区域自动气象站是指一种用于监测和记录天气和气候参数的自动化气象观测站。
这些站点广泛分布于特定地理区域,并通过无线技术将收集到的气象数据发送到中央服务器进行分析和处理。
区域自动气象站在气象学、农业、能源、交通等领域的应用具有重要意义,并对大规模气象研究和预测提供关键数据。
1. 区域自动气象站的功能1.1 气象观测:区域自动气象站能够实时、准确地测量和记录大气压力、温度、湿度、降水量、风向和风速等气象要素。
通过这些数据,气象学家和研究人员可以监测并理解天气的变化和气候的趋势。
1.2 预警系统:区域自动气象站能够监测异常的气象活动并及时发出警报,提醒民众采取相应的防护措施。
例如,当飓风、暴雨、雷暴等恶劣天气即将到来时,自动气象站的数据将会触发相应的预警信息,以保护民众的生命和财产安全。
1.3 数据分析:区域自动气象站收集的气象数据可以用于分析和预测气候变化、气象灾害、作物生长等情况。
通过对这些数据进行统计和建模,政府和研究机构可以制定相应的即时决策和措施,以适应不断变化的气候条件。
2. 区域自动气象站的优势2.1 自动化和高效性:区域自动气象站的自动化系统可以实现无人值守的运行,并保持数据的准确性和一致性。
这种高效性不仅减少了人力成本,还提高了数据的时效性和可靠性。
2.2 节约成本:相比传统的手动气象观测站,区域自动气象站在设备和运维上具有更低的成本。
并且,由于其智能化的数据采集和传输系统,大量气象数据可以远程收集和传输,减少了人员的工作量和成本。
2.3 多功能性:区域自动气象站可以灵活地部署在各种地理环境中,满足不同行业和领域的需求。
无论是在农业、能源、交通还是环境监测等领域,这些站点都可以提供有关天气和气候的重要数据,用于决策和规划。
3. 应用案例3.1 农业:区域自动气象站的数据在农业领域的应用非常广泛。
气象仪器检定自动化及数据共享平台的开发作者:石建峰来源:《中国科技纵横》2018年第06期摘要:目前气象部门使用的计量检定设备还处于传统阶段,把气象仪器检定自动化成了关注的话题,在改造上给出了各子系统的设计原理的程序步骤,采用串行通信技术实现检定数据的自动采取,并且建立检定数据库等。
这个平台的建设,可以实现检定系统全面自动化,减轻了劳动力度,排除因为人为检查出现的误差,在减少时间的同时提高整个工作效率。
关键词:自动化;气象仪器;检定;平台中图分类号:TH765 文献标识码:A 文章编号:1671-2064(2018)06-0028-02气象仪器的检定是整个气象部门最基本的服务系统,可以保证气象技术装备检测到最精准的资料,可靠的量值传递是气象检测的一种保证。
在气象现代化建设发展中,气象的计量检定系统建设遭到停懈,在计量方法上已经远远不能满足现气象现代化发展需求,不能满足越来越多的气象仪器检定的需要。
为了提高检测工作的工作效率,避免因为认为而产生的误差,降低检测人员的劳动强度,并且提高检测的精准度已经准确度,对气象仪器、自动化的检测需求,要想解决目前的问题就必须要让自动气象站的方法规范、配置自动气象站的检定准则,研究出一个检定综合管理的平台,以适应自动化建设发展的需求,实现现代化计量、质量的管理与信息资源管理的体系。
1 传统地面气象观察仪器1.1 气温检测仪器我国采用了地面气象观测温度传感器之后,气温的检测实现了数字化的现实与自动化的观测。
通过其把以往玻璃液体的温度检测表,在未来的几年内被淘汰掉。
因为地面检测温度传感器具有很高的分辨度与稳定性,在一定的时期内曾经是往气温测量方向进行发展的[1]。
目前很多地面气象自动观测以上都使用了四线的铂电阻,这种温度测量的方法可以说很满足气象组织的测量,其精准度也达到了需求状态,其中测量的误差不是很大,采用了较高的电路器把误差降到了最低。
铂电阻温度传感器,可以在今后受到很大的推广,其稳定性很强,在未来气象检测组织内可以常见这种检测仪器。
第4期 气象水文海洋仪器 No.42013年12月 Meteorological,Hydrological and Marine Instruments Dec.2013收稿日期:2013-08-10.作者简介:吕雪芹(1980-),女,硕士,工程师.现从事气象装备监控与保障工作.省级区域自动气象站站网综合管理系统的设计与实现吕雪琴,雷卫延,陈冰怀(广东省大气探测技术中心,广州510080)摘 要:针对区域自动气象站管理中存在的问题,设计开发了基于B/S构架的省级区域自动气象站站网综合管理系统。
该系统由业务管理子系统、市局业务子系统、业务保障子系统和账号管理子系4个部分组成,系统满足气象业务管理流程需求,能够实现省、市二级部门气象业务部门在线处理区域自动站站网的管理业务,为区域自动气象站网高效管理提供有力的支持平台。
关键词:气象站网;子系统;B/S架构;业务流程;系统设计中图分类号:TP274 文献标识码:A 文章编号:1006-009X(2013)04-0069-04Design and implementation of network integrated management systemfor provincial regional automatic weather stationLüXueqin,Lei Weiyan,Chen Binghuai(Guangdong Atmospheric Observation Technology Center,Guangzhou510080)Abstract:Aiming at the management problems existed in provincial regional automatic weatherstation,the network integrated management system based on the B/S framework is designed anddeveloped.This system consists of four parts.They are business management subsystem,municipalservice subsystem,business assurance subsystem and account management subsystem.This systemalso meets the demand of management process for meteorological services,which can on-line deal withnetwork management of regional automatic weather station and provide a strong support platform forefficiency management of the weather station network.Key words:weather station network;subsystem;B/S framework;business process;system design0 引言随着广东省自动气象站建设步伐的加快,区域自动站从最初的几百个台站,发展到目前已有2000多台站。
气象数据共享平台的建设与管理随着科技的飞速发展和社会的不断进步,气象数据在各个领域的应用越来越广泛。
从农业生产到交通运输,从能源开发到城市规划,准确、及时、全面的气象数据对于提高决策的科学性、降低风险、保障公共安全和促进经济发展都具有至关重要的意义。
在此背景下,建设一个高效、可靠、便捷的气象数据共享平台成为了时代的迫切需求。
一、气象数据共享平台建设的必要性气象数据具有多样性、复杂性和时效性等特点。
不同类型的气象数据,如气温、降水、风速、风向、气压等,需要进行综合分析和处理,才能为用户提供有价值的信息。
同时,气象数据的来源也非常广泛,包括气象观测站、卫星遥感、雷达监测等。
由于这些数据分散在不同的部门和机构中,缺乏有效的整合和共享,导致数据的利用率低下,重复建设现象严重。
因此,建设一个气象数据共享平台,实现气象数据的集中管理和统一发布,不仅可以提高数据的利用效率,减少资源浪费,还可以促进气象科研和业务的协同发展,为气象服务的创新提供有力支撑。
二、气象数据共享平台的建设目标1、数据整合将来自不同渠道、不同格式的气象数据进行整合,建立统一的数据标准和规范,确保数据的一致性和准确性。
2、数据存储采用先进的数据库技术和存储设备,确保海量气象数据的安全存储和快速检索。
3、数据共享通过网络技术,实现气象数据的在线共享,为用户提供便捷的数据访问服务。
4、数据分析提供数据分析工具和算法,帮助用户挖掘数据中的潜在价值,为决策提供支持。
5、系统安全建立完善的安全机制,保障气象数据的安全性和保密性。
三、气象数据共享平台的架构设计气象数据共享平台的架构通常包括数据源层、数据存储层、数据处理层、数据服务层和用户应用层。
1、数据源层负责收集来自各种气象观测设备、卫星遥感、数值预报模型等的原始数据。
2、数据存储层采用关系型数据库和分布式文件系统相结合的方式,存储结构化和非结构化的气象数据。
3、数据处理层运用数据清洗、转换、融合等技术,对原始数据进行预处理,提高数据质量。
区域自动气象站数据读取辅助软件设计及应用区域自动气象站数据读取辅助软件设计及应用一、引言气象是一个与人们生活息息相关的重要领域,准确的气象数据对于人类生产、生活和安全具有重要意义。
气象站通过收集气象数据,为气象部门和公众提供重要的气象信息。
然而,传统的人工读取气象站数据存在效率低下、容易出错等问题。
为了提高工作效率和数据准确性,本文设计了一款区域自动气象站数据读取辅助软件,并将其在实际应用中进行了验证。
二、软件设计1. 软件功能设计该软件主要具有以下功能:(1)气象站数据自动读取:通过与气象站设备的接口进行数据通信,自动读取气象站采集的数据。
(2)数据存储和备份:将读取的气象数据存储至数据库中,并进行定期备份,以防止数据丢失。
(3)数据展示和分析:根据用户的需求,以图表等形式展示气象数据,并提供数据分析功能,如数据趋势分析、异常值检测等。
(4)警报和预警功能:根据设定的阈值,监测气象数据,并在出现异常情况时,及时发送警报和预警信息。
2. 软件架构设计该软件采用C/S(客户端/服务器)架构,包括前端客户端和后台服务器两部分。
前端客户端用于用户与软件的交互,包括数据查询、图表展示、数据分析等功能;后台服务器负责气象数据的读取、存储、分析和报警等工作。
三、软件应用1. 实际应用环境介绍本软件在某地区的气象部门进行了应用测试,该地区设置了多个自动气象站,用于监测气温、湿度、风速等数据。
2. 应用案例以某个气象站的温度监测为例,通过该软件读取数据并进行分析。
用户打开软件客户端,选择相应的气象站并设定时间范围,点击查询按钮后,软件即刻进行与气象站的数据通信,自动读取相关数据,并将数据存储至数据库中。
用户可以通过图表展示功能查看气温随时间的变化趋势,并利用数据分析功能检测是否存在异常值。
软件还提供了预警功能,当气温超过设定阈值时,自动发送警报信息至相关人员手机。
3. 应用效果评估通过使用该软件,气象部门工作人员无需手动读取气象站数据,大大提高了工作效率。
自动气象站论文:自动气象站数据管理与应用系统的设计与实现【中文摘要】自动气象站在气象观测系统中具有十分重要的作用。
它不但大大提高了气象服务能力,同时也为各级领导指挥抗洪救灾提供真实可靠的决策依据。
但大量的自动气象站观测信息在为气象服务工作提供了更好的数据支撑的同时,也给气象信息的传输、处理和应用带来了新的压力,因此针对自动气象站的数据管理和应用方面的研究势在必行。
本论文正是针对上述问题,以自动气象站观测数据为主要研究对象,结合气象行业观测数据标准化规定,对自动气象站观测数据的管理和应用进行研究和探索,设计开发了自动气象站数据管理与应用系统。
主要研究内容包括:1.自动气象站观测数据的存储管理。
通过对气象行业标准的学习和研究,完成了不同类型自动气象站观测数据的格式规范化,建立自动气象站观测数据存储数据库,将观测数据实时存入数据库中。
2.自动气象站观测数据的处理。
在对自动气象站观测数据进行格式规范化处理后,将其写入数据库中,并提供了质量控制功能。
同时按行业标准格式,提供了生成地面气象观测数据月文件、报表文件和单要素月文件等功能。
3.自动气象站观测数据的查询和应用。
根据业务需求,通过SQL语句提供单站查询、全站查询、雨量查询和高级查询等多种查询功能,能够对自动气象站运行情况、数据到报率进行监控和统计。
4.通过地理信息系统实现雨量、温度等观测要素数据的直观显示,方便业务人员及时了解全地区天气形势的变化。
本系统开发部署后,使营口市气象局自动气象站的应用取得了较高的效益。
一是数据规范化完成了观测数据的整合,便于数据的统一管理和应用。
二是SQL SERVER 2005数据库为不同规模的企业构建了经济有效的BI(Business Intelligence)解决方案,能够满足气象部门对自动气象站观测数据的存储和应用需求。
三是GPRS无线通讯技术解决了自动气象站与气象局间的数据通讯问题。
四是.NET 开发平台功能非常丰富,有利于气象工作者开发稳定、可靠的业务软件。